Teb
9612 Las Tunas Dr
Temple City, CA 91780
Echo Base Toys is a collectible shop located in Covina, California, specializing in a range of pop culture merchandise. The shop is known for its dedicated service and commitment to processing orders efficiently.
The team at Echo Base Toys participates in various events, such as the Emerald City Comic-Con, showcasing their passion for the collectibles community. Customers are encouraged to stay updated on store news and offerings through their social media channels.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.


